When Functioning with alcohol based mostly markers, like Copic Markers, You should definitely get an extra clean paper with small tooth, so which the pens glide over the paper. Little details will present up greater on easy paper, in lieu of the Alcoholic beverages markers pooling during the paper’s tooth.

Use White Ink or Correction Pens: While traditional erasing isn’t attainable, you can from time to time use white ink or correction pens to deal with little errors. This may be specially efficient in lighter areas of the drawing.
Brushes: Brushes are beneficial for implementing ink washes and creating textures in your drawings. Pick brushes with various bristle types and dimensions to achieve many different outcomes.

Cross-hatching builds upon the hatching technique by introducing A further layer of strains that cross the 1st set, normally at an angle.
